30% is the maximum. That is close. It is not a 'rare' as in the sense of this forum, but one does not see it very often!

I believe the only reason for the exceptional mod would be making spellbooks, as nothing else of note can be made exceptional with the inscription skill. (Runebooks, sure, but nobody cares.) :)

However, as far as I know, there is no benefit to an exceptionally-marked spellbook.

The only benefit that is rumored to exist would be a hidden one, that folks wearing a 30/30 talisman craft better spellbooks (a larger percentage of them have 3 mods). This is akin to crafters swearing that high luck suits improve their odds -- unproven, and in fact, argued against by people who can read the server code. Is that the case with this talisman rumor? I have no idea.

Other than the above rumor, I have not noticed any benefit to making an exceptional spellbook, other than having my name on it. The only way that most of us accept as the method of improving the odds of 3-mod books is to raise magery to 110 or better, 120. This is what the developers have designed. Of course, in the code, there may be other considerations that we are unaware of. But, unless an official statement is made, any rumors are unproven..... so anyone can say anything. :)

I did answer the question, I apologize if the answer is hard to understand.

Lets try this: Scrappers cannot be exceptionally crafted, and there is no difference between exceptional and regular spellbooks.
